Veteran coach Josef Emmanuel Sarpong has stepped down as head coach of Eleven Wonders, bringing an early end to his brief spell in charge ahead of their Ghana Premier League match against Hohoe United this weekend.Reports indicate that Sarpong tendered his resignation on Friday, just 20 days after taking over the role on November 2.His departure comes after a difficult run in which the team lost all three matches under his supervision. The Ghana Science & Tech Explorer Challenge Prize (GSTEP) has officially begun preparations for its 2026 challenge by inducting a new cohort of 20 Youth Ambassadors. The induction ceremony, held on Saturday, November 15, 2025, in Accra, welcomed five young leaders from each of the four participating regions: Greater Accra, Eastern, Ashanti, and Volta. Medeama SC head coach Tanko Ibrahim has been voted the NASCO Ghana Premier League Fans' Coach of the Month for October after guiding his side through a strong and disciplined run of form.The experienced trainer oversaw an unbeaten month, securing three victories and one draw, with his team scoring six goals and conceding three. The Coalition of Unemployed Trained Teachers (CUTT) has expressed disappointment over Education Minister, Haruna Iddrisu’s announcement that government will recruit only 6,100 teachers this year. In a statement dated 20th November 2025, the group said the figure is far below what the Minister announced in Parliament earlier in June. The Weija Divisional Police Command has commenced investigations into the tragic death of a 13-year-old girl, Celestine Adonteng, who was allegedly subjected to severe physical abuse by her father, Isaac Adonteng, at Kokrobite.
